Atrinik Server  4.0
Data Fields
atrinik_plugin Struct Reference

#include <plugin.h>

Data Fields

f_plug_event eventfunc
 
f_plug_pinit closefunc
 
LIBPTRTYPE libptr
 
char id [MAX_BUF]
 
char fullname [MAX_BUF]
 
int8_t gevent [GEVENT_NUM]
 
struct atrinik_pluginnext
 

Detailed Description

One loaded plugin.

Definition at line 214 of file plugin.h.

Field Documentation

f_plug_pinit atrinik_plugin::closefunc

Plugin closePlugin function.

Definition at line 219 of file plugin.h.

f_plug_event atrinik_plugin::eventfunc

Event handler function.

Definition at line 216 of file plugin.h.

char atrinik_plugin::fullname[MAX_BUF]

Plugin's full name.

Definition at line 228 of file plugin.h.

int8_t atrinik_plugin::gevent[GEVENT_NUM]

Global events registered.

Definition at line 231 of file plugin.h.

char atrinik_plugin::id[MAX_BUF]

Plugin identification string.

Definition at line 225 of file plugin.h.

LIBPTRTYPE atrinik_plugin::libptr

Pointer to the plugin library.

Definition at line 222 of file plugin.h.

struct atrinik_plugin* atrinik_plugin::next

Next plugin in list.

Definition at line 234 of file plugin.h.


The documentation for this struct was generated from the following file: